Vittorito
Vittorito is a village in Vittorito, L’Aquila, Abruzzo and has about 1,010 residents. Vittorito is situated nearby to the village Corfinio, as well as near the hamlet Loc. Ind. Artig. e Comm.Impianata.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Raiano railway station
Railway station
Raiano is a railway station in Raiano, Italy. The station is located on the Terni–Sulmona railway. The train services are operated by Trenitalia. Raiano railway station is situated 3½ km south of Vittorito.
Hermitage of San Venanzio
Church
Photo: Raboe001,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Hermitage of San Venanzio is the site the ancient hermitage of Saint Venantius of Camerino, located above a stream in a remote ravine within a few kilometers north of Raiano, Province of L'Aquila in the Abruzzo, Italy. Hermitage of San Venanzio is situated 2½ km southwest of Vittorito.

Bussi sul Tirino
Village
Photo: Raboe001,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Bussi sul Tirino is a comune and town in the province of Pescara in the Abruzzo region of Italy. It is located in the Gran Sasso e Monti della Laga National Park. Bussi sul Tirino is situated 10 km north of Vittorito.
